THE WEATHER.

FORECAST AND OBSERVATIONS Following is the official weather foreCast for 24 hours from 9 ajn. this day:— The indications are for southerly winds, strong to gale at times. The weather will probably prove cold and showery. The night will probably be very cold. Barometer rising. Seas, rough off shore. Tides good.
